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0566867631 7123775959 27053154
93986316 90245922168
93986316 90245922168
845 7615142 616092184
All about undefined
Interested in learning more?
93986316 90245922168
845 7615142 616092184
See more
251304125 79
2832432 42 85 193 237711
See more
22574 2735 117900624
45472 51586814 2514098 4446 838714
See more